17) I don't what the recent hidden update did, but it seems to have screwed something else up. Now, when I leave (or enter) a Forge session, the program automatically groups my duplicates to the original. I created a simple structure, duplicated it, move the duplicate to the map, and then duplicated it again. Each structure was set as their own individual groups. Four total, with the original two structures playing the part of templates for future structures. I saved, and quit Forge. Later, I returned to find they were all grouped together. Thinking I had screwed up, I un-grouped them and then re-grouped them as they should have been. I once again saved and quit Forge just to test it. Sure enough, when I entered the map, they were all grouped together again. This needs to be fixed for it can and will cause a lot of issues. I'm thinking it may be tied to the item's colors. For after I changed the colors of one structure, it repeated the process only with those of the same colors.

18) After that, I continued with my map. And started to play with the world settings. Mostly the clouds and the wind. I noticed that the wind did not effect the trees at all. No matter how high I set the wind, the trees would not budge. I switched to player mode and even tried rendering the map, so no effect to the trees.

19) While I was testing the world settings, the entire game crashed. Thankfully, I had already saved earlier and did not loose any progress, this time. But with the crash, came a new glitch. And of course, it had to be another bad one. Remember those structures that kept auto-grouping? Yeah, well, now I can't even touch them. Their original template (of different colors) is still intractable. But the gray duplicates can no longer be manipulated at all. I got right up to them and they would not highlight, let me select them, nor show their names. Even the hand icon goes dim. Instead, it selects/highlights items behind it.
